Aide_Java_Windows
Sk@n
-
KX Messages postés 19031 Statut Modérateur -
KX Messages postés 19031 Statut Modérateur -
Bonjour,
me voilà bien embêté... Je vous explique, je me débrouille bien en langage C mais voilà que je dois me mettre au JAVA pour mon école...
Le problème est que je ne souhaite pas, pour l'instant passer sous Linux (mais je ne vais pas tarder), donc je me trouve avec mon "super" windows seven de ***** et je suis un peu perdu car je ne sais pas du tout comment m'y prendre pour compiler en java.
J'aimerais bien que l'on m'explique comment faire et si possible le pourquoi du comment!!
J'entends par là pourquoi on doit installé JDK et tout ça (mais c'est "accessoirement" dans un premier temps je veux surtout compiler!! ).
En vous remerciant d'avance !!
Bien cordialement
Sk@n
me voilà bien embêté... Je vous explique, je me débrouille bien en langage C mais voilà que je dois me mettre au JAVA pour mon école...
Le problème est que je ne souhaite pas, pour l'instant passer sous Linux (mais je ne vais pas tarder), donc je me trouve avec mon "super" windows seven de ***** et je suis un peu perdu car je ne sais pas du tout comment m'y prendre pour compiler en java.
J'aimerais bien que l'on m'explique comment faire et si possible le pourquoi du comment!!
J'entends par là pourquoi on doit installé JDK et tout ça (mais c'est "accessoirement" dans un premier temps je veux surtout compiler!! ).
En vous remerciant d'avance !!
Bien cordialement
Sk@n
3 réponses
Bonjour,
Pour programmer en JAVA, que ce soit sous Windows, Mac, LINUX, il vous faut effectivement le jdk. Ce package contient les classes de base Java ainsi que les outils pour fabriquer le pseudo code.
On ne compile pas vraiment en Java, on fait un pseudo code, qui est interprété par JAVA.
Pour compiler, il faut utiliser la commande javac programme.java
Cette commande va générer un ou plusieurs fichiers .class
Pour exécuter le programme il faudra ensuite lancer java programme
Mais sincèrement, je conseille d'utiliser Eclipse ou NetBeans pour programmer en Java, tout est intégré, beaucoup moins de prise de tête pour le déploiement etc...
Pour programmer en JAVA, que ce soit sous Windows, Mac, LINUX, il vous faut effectivement le jdk. Ce package contient les classes de base Java ainsi que les outils pour fabriquer le pseudo code.
On ne compile pas vraiment en Java, on fait un pseudo code, qui est interprété par JAVA.
Pour compiler, il faut utiliser la commande javac programme.java
Cette commande va générer un ou plusieurs fichiers .class
Pour exécuter le programme il faudra ensuite lancer java programme
Mais sincèrement, je conseille d'utiliser Eclipse ou NetBeans pour programmer en Java, tout est intégré, beaucoup moins de prise de tête pour le déploiement etc...
Le compilateur c'est javac et pour l'avoir il te faut installer la JDK...
Donc installes la JDK (en le téléchargeant ici) et après utilises javac pour compiler.
Remarque : sous Linux aussi il faudrait l'installer, ce n'est pas spécifique à Windows.
Les avantages et les inconvénients de Java sont les mêmes sous Linux et Windows !
Donc installes la JDK (en le téléchargeant ici) et après utilises javac pour compiler.
Remarque : sous Linux aussi il faudrait l'installer, ce n'est pas spécifique à Windows.
Les avantages et les inconvénients de Java sont les mêmes sous Linux et Windows !
Parfait !!
Je dois partir là mais je pense prendre mon pied à prendre en main java toute la nuit si tout fonctionne bien!!
Un grand merci à vous cela va me permettre d'avancer déjà et cela me semble un peu plus claire. Je pense utiliser Eclipse dans un premiers temps avant de jouer le chaud.
Impressionné de la réactivité de se forum je le conseillerai dorénavant.
Encore merci,
Kenavo !!
Sk@n
Je dois partir là mais je pense prendre mon pied à prendre en main java toute la nuit si tout fonctionne bien!!
Un grand merci à vous cela va me permettre d'avancer déjà et cela me semble un peu plus claire. Je pense utiliser Eclipse dans un premiers temps avant de jouer le chaud.
Impressionné de la réactivité de se forum je le conseillerai dorénavant.
Encore merci,
Kenavo !!
Sk@n
Oui j'ai pu voir ce logiciel sur internet mais lorsque je souhaite l'installer il m'ouvre une magnifique fenêtre :
" The Eclipsec executable launcher was unable to locate its companion shared library "
Ce que je comprends de ce message est qu'il y a un problème avec les bibliothèques...
Je ne comprends pas.
Mais qu'est ce que ce JDK cela référence toutes les bibliothèques?
Il fait appel à un server?
Parce que avec les compilateurs tel que DevC++ les bibliothèques sont déjà présente dans le soft (du moins une bonne partie). Cela veut donc dire que si je veux compiler sur un poste il me faut absolument les 2 softs d'installé?
Merci
Et oui pour compiler il te faut forcément le compilateur d'installé. En revanche l'IDE n'est pas nécessaire pour compiler ou lancer le programme un bloc-notes et une ligne de commande suffit !